What can you do if you’re in a relationship that has turned physically violent? What if a family member is in a relationship and you have suspicions about it being abusive – what should you do? Ciara chats to CEO of Women’s Aid Sarah Benson. 

If you are, or think you may be in an abusive relationship, you can ring Women's Aid National Freephone Helpline 1800 341 900. For men who may be experiencing domestic violence they can contact AnyMan Confidential National Support Line on 01 5543811
